Amanohashidate, a picturesque sandbar stretching nearly 3.6 miles across the inlet of Miyazu Bay, is the first destination on this day tour.

Visitors have 2.75 hours of free time to explore this scenic natural wonder. They can stroll along the bridge, take in panoramic views from Kasamatsu Park’s observatory, or enjoy a traditional Japanese pork shabu-shabu lunch.

The tour includes the Kasamatsu Park ropeway ticket, allowing easy access to the hilltop observatory that offers breathtaking vistas of the "Bridge to Heaven."

After exploring the serene Amanohashidate, the tour continues to the picturesque fishing village of Ine.

During the guided tour, visitors will discover:

  1. The unique funaya, or boathouses, that line the shore, allowing the villagers to live and work directly on the water.

  2. A relaxing boat cruise along the scenic Ine Bay, offering breathtaking views of the quaint village and its surroundings.

  3. Opportunities to immerse in the local culture and traditions, learning about the centuries-old fishing practices that have sustained the community.

The Ine portion of the tour provides a serene and authentic glimpse into the Japanese coastal way of life.
